Episode 18: The “Direct Primary Care” Model w/ Matt Dinsmore, ARNP

During this episode, Matt Dinsmore shares information on several key topics:

->> Topic #1: The difference between the “direct primary care” model and the “fee-for-service” model. What are the pros and cons of each?

->> Topic #2: The problems and barriers involved with using insurance companies (when insurance companies dictate your care instead of physicians).

->> Topic #3: Is the “direct primary care” (DPC) model for everyone… or only healthier people who don’t use their health insurance much to begin with? Learn how this model can be beneficial for a wide range of people, even those on Medicare.

->> Topic #4: How does DPC work? What services are covered, and how do you handle more expensive procedures that aren’t included?

->> Topic #5: Costs for enrolling with DPC.
